At its core, Dusk is a layer-one blockchain built from scratch. Its standout feature is the use of zero-knowledge proofs, a form of advanced cryptography that lets the network verify transactions without revealing details like sender, recipient, or amount. Think of it as proving you followed the rules without anyone seeing what you actually did. For banks, investment firms, and professional users, this is a game-changer.

The network uses a specialized proof-of-stake system designed for speed and certainty. Transactions finalize quickly and cannot be rolled back, which is essential for financial operations where timing and accuracy matter. Validators stake DUSK tokens to secure the chain and earn rewards in return, creating a strong incentive for long-term network stability.

Dusk isn’t just about moving traditional finance onto the blockchain; it’s about doing it in a controlled, compliant way. Its system for tokenized securities lets real financial assets exist on-chain with built-in rules. Only approved users can hold these assets, transfers can be region-limited, and compliance checks can happen automatically—all without exposing private data. Imagine issuing shares, managing dividends, or running private fundraising directly on blockchain in a fully legal, efficient way.

The DUSK token is the backbone of the ecosystem. It’s used to pay transaction fees, stake to secure the network, deploy smart contracts, and eventually govern the protocol. With a capped supply of 1 billion tokens, half was available early, while the rest is released gradually to support steady, long-term growth rather than short-term speculation.

Dusk also supports smart contracts, but with a focus on privacy and efficiency. Developers familiar with Ethereum can build on Dusk while taking advantage of its privacy-first architecture. The network separates core blockchain operations from application execution, ensuring scalability and avoiding slow, expensive transactions.
